Quantum Marketing: Mastering the New Marketing Mindset for Tomorrow’s Consumers – A Game-Changer for the Modern Marketer

Overview

Raja Rajamannar’s “Quantum Marketing” is a fascinating book that examines how marketing is changing quickly in the face of unparalleled technical breakthroughs. Rajamannar claims that the fifth paradigm of marketing, which he refers to as “Quantum Marketing,” is about to take hold, and he utilises this book to lay out a thorough framework for comprehending and capitalising on this upcoming change. The interconnection of evolving technologies, the complexity of consumer interactions, and the necessity for marketers to fundamentally rethink their strategy are the key themes discussed.

Key Ideas and Book Structure

“Quantum Marketing” divides the marketing evolution into five paradigms in a straightforward, logical manner. The first four paradigms—product marketing, emotional marketing, data-driven marketing, and digital marketing—lay the foundation for the future period by giving it context. The most important idea is found in Rajamannar’s fifth paradigm, Quantum Marketing, where he emphasises the value of comprehending cutting-edge technology like artificial intelligence (AI), quantum computing, and 5G. He emphasises that in order to design successful strategies in this new era, marketers must gain a deeper understanding of these technologies.

The interconnection of technology and how they magnify each other’s effects are significant themes in “Quantum Marketing,” leading to a quantum-like behaviour in marketing tactics and results. The increasing complexity and sophistication of consumers is another important topic, underscoring the need for marketers to be equally as astute in their approaches. The necessity for marketers to upgrade their skills, innovate, and adapt in this era of quick technological change is another constant theme throughout the book.

Criticisms and Strengths

“Quantum Marketing” has a forward-thinking outlook, which is one of its strongest points. Rajamannar’s vast expertise and vision offer marketers navigating this new period a useful road map. Another of his strengths is his capacity to distil complex ideas into understandable ones.

The book could be faulted, nevertheless, for having a too positive perspective of technology. Some readers could believe that it minimises the potential drawbacks of these new technology, such as privacy and data security issues. Rajamannar acknowledges these problems, but a deeper investigation would have given the story more substance.
